Group BTS has been named on the United States of America Billboard main album chart for the 30th week.

According to the latest chart released by Billboard on Wednesday, BTS' repackaged album "Love Yourself Reason Answer" peaked at #115 on the Billboard 200.

The album entered the Billboard 200 in September last year and has been on the chart for 30 consecutive weeks and continues to be popular.

In addition, 'Love Your Self-Reflective Anthur' ranked # 1 in the world album, # 15 in the Independent album, and # Billboard Canadian album 89.

"Love Yourself Former Tier" ranked second in the world album, 16th in the Independent album, and "Face Yourself" in Japan's third album, ranked sixth in the world album.

BTS has recorded its longest consecutive record for 89 consecutive weeks on the social 50 charts and has set the 119th record for the first time in its career.

BTS will release its new album, "Map of the Soul: Persona (MAP OF THE SOUL: PERSONA), on April 12th.
